Bitter cold snap lessens salt’s effectiveness As the temperature drops, salt’s effectiveness slows to the point that when you get down near 10 degrees and below, salt hardly works at all. Keep in mind that this is for nighttime temperatures; salt is effective at these very cold temperatures in sunshine.

Web16 de jun. de 2024 · How cold does salt work? In the highway deicing world the practical working temperature of salt is generally considered to be above 15 0F or even 20 0F. There are two reasons for this. One is that the amount of ice that can be melted per pound of salt (or any other deicer) decreases with temperature. What does salt on roads do? Web27 de abr. de 2024 · Why Does Rock Salt Make Ice Colder? Place a cup containing pure water next to one containing salty water and gradually lower the ambient temperature. At around 0 degrees Celsius (32 degrees Fahrenheit) the pure water will ice over and gradually freeze while the salty water remains liquid.
